Transaction bddc5b773c282d0a3a2f29d8a21bcbf395fa5ea7dfe3a0e0db69a9cf1cdd3f01

25 Input
1 Outputs
  • bddc5b773c282d0a3a2f29d8a21bcbf395fa5ea7dfe3a0e0db69a9cf1cdd3f01:0
  • value  4269081526
    address  12HvhjYrU6evYfvzeEBvn5JdXG2UjkfcpC